    Area of Science:

    • Pulmonary Medicine
    • Morphometry
    • Pathology

    Background:

    • Emphysema is a lung disease characterized by destruction of alveoli.
    • Quantifying emphysema's impact on lung structure is crucial for understanding disease progression.
    • Traditional morphometric measures may not fully capture the physical property changes.

    Purpose of the Study:

    • To investigate the relationship between lung surface area and emphysema extent/type.
    • To evaluate specific surface area as a metric for emphysema assessment.
    • To explore the morphologic origins of different emphysema types.

    Main Methods:

    • Autopsy examination of 69 male lungs.
    • Measurement of internal surface area per unit lung volume (specific surface area).
    • Correlation analysis between emphysema percentage, lung volume, and specific surface area.

    Main Results:

    • Specific surface area significantly decreased with increasing emphysema percentage (r=-0.574).
    • Lungs with minimal emphysema showed reduced specific surface area compared to healthy lungs.
    • The decline in specific surface area was consistent across centrilobular, panlobular, and mixed emphysema types.

    Conclusions:

    • Specific surface area is a sensitive indicator of emphysema's physical impact on lungs.
    • Minimal emphysema degrees can alter lung properties.
    • Panlobular emphysema may develop from extensive centrilobular lesions, supported by age and prevalence data.
